An experienced team that can boast many successfully organized cultural events. Cinema Art Foundation was created by the group of people who have been involved with the film environment for many years. They have organized film workshops, seminars, contests and festivals both on local and international level.
Among others, they organized World Independent Film Festivals UNICA (1997, 2003, 2009), each hosting over 400 hundred people from 30 countries. Presently, Foundation Cinema Art is also a co-organiser of the OFF/ON Warsaw European Film Week and the Re:visions, Independent Art Invasion as well as the initiator and the unique organizer of the Young Cinema Art, World Student Film Festival and Grand OFF, World Off Film Awards.
The Foundation also organized “Pointe to Point” and “Rotations” dance projects. Cinema Art Foundation essentially aims at facilitating access to art and culture. Promoting various forms of cultural projects, involving people from different backgrounds, we combine art and culture with education. To this end, we have established a fruitful cooperation with professional film circles, cultural organizations and independent filmmakers from all over the world.

WITLOD KON
Festival director
President of Cinema Art Foundation

Cultural animator and social worker with over 30 years of experience. Active in the independent film „industry” since 1982. He started and produced the first twelve editions of the Child and Teenage Amateur International Film Festival (present name MFF Dozwolone do 21/UP TO 21). He was the Director of the 53rd and 65th UNICA World Film Festival and served two terms as the Vice President of FAKF Festival. Since 1993 he’s been the President of the Federation of Independent Filmmakers. Awarded the Golden Medal of UNICA. Director of Young Cinema Art – the World Student Film Festival. The founding father of the Grand Off – European Off Film Awards.
